SUNY/CUNY SEAC EXHIBITION & LAUNCH

City College of New York, Downtown Campus, 17 April through June 2024

Our exhibition and showcase—RESBAK! Arts & Resistance Against the Drug Killings in the Philippines—coincided with CCNY’s Third Critical Perspectives on Human Rights Conference, which aimed to explore the contested legacy of human rights in increasingly uncertain times. RESBAK (RESpond and Break the Silence Against the Killings) is an interdisciplinary alliance of artists, media practitioners, and cultural workers. Its primary goal is to advance social awareness regarding the killings that the Duterte administration’s “war and drugs” instigated. Featuring RESBAK members and works, we present photography, visual art, and multimedia—and at the conference, opportunities for sharing and discussion—that confront the consequences and aftermath of Duterte’s “war on drugs,” particularly its impact on poor and marginalized communities. The program serves as both a tribute to the victims and a call for justice, encouraging viewers to consider the human cost of political actions.
